注意,本文编辑使用了latex语法,可以参考常用数学符号表示法latex帮助。
1. T(n)=T(n/2)+c
解:替换法
到这里假设,则上式等于
2. T(n)=4T(n/2)+n
解:主方法,a=4,b=2,f(n)=n, 因此,可知
,满足主方法第一条定理
所以
3. T(n)=4T(n/2)+c
解:替换法
到这里假设,则上式等于
,如果T(1)=1,则有
4. T(n)=4T(n/2)+n^2
解:主方法,a=4,b=2,f(n)=n^2,因此,也就是
,所以不符合主定理第一条,套用第二条,可知k=0,则有
本文探讨如何利用主方法解决递归函数问题,通过举例分析了不同类型的递归公式,如T(n)=T(n/2)+c和T(n)=4T(n/2)+n^2,解释了主方法在解决这些递归关系时的应用和适用条件。

5084

被折叠的 条评论
为什么被折叠?



